Jennifer Lawrence, Michael Fassbender, James McAvoy will return to “X-Men” movie franchise in “Dark Phoenix”

As previously announced by 20th Century Fox, the next film in the main “X-Men” movie series will be entitled “X-Men: Dark Phoenix,” centering around the character of Jean Grey, now played by actress Sophie Turner of HBO’s fantasy drama “Game of Thrones.”

What we didn’t know until today was whether fellow cast members James McAvoy (Professor Xavier), Michael Fassbender (Magneto), or Jennifer Lawrence (Mystique) would return to reprise their characters, perhaps the three most popular in the current post-“First Class” run of “X-Men” features, based on the long-running Marvel comic books of the same name.

The three well-known actors were previously only contracted for a trilogy of movies, which concluded with 2016’s “X-Men: Apocalypse,” but today the trade publication Deadline Hollywood revealed that they would indeed return for a fourth outing, alongside Nicholas Hoult (Beast), Alexandra Shipp (Storm), Tye Sheridan (Cyclops), Kodi Smit-McPhee (Nightcrawler), and the aforementioned Turner.

“X-Men: Dark Phoenix” is currently scheduled for a November 2nd, 2018 release, with Simon Kinberg (writer/producer of the last few “X-Men” movies) taking over as director from series mastermind Bryan Singer.
